小编Bob*_*ack的帖子

彩色、编号、分页的 git diff

git diff语法着色、分页的默认行为非常好用,但如果使用行号作为上下文会更好一些,特别是对于较大的差异,尤其是对于最后一页。

git diff | nl | more
Run Code Online (Sandbox Code Playgroud)

几乎给了我我需要的一切,但它丢弃了着色;有什么办法可以拿回来吗?

command-line

7
推荐指数
1
解决办法
2797
查看次数

在 OSX 上模拟 /etc/cron.d/

在大多数现代 UNIX 上,cron 支持以下位置的单个 crontab 文件:/etc/cron.d,其中每个任务都以指定用户的身份执行。这些文件编辑后会自动更新 crontab。它们允许各个软件包安装自己的自动化任务,而不会污染全局 crontab 或使用特定于用户的 crontab。

\n\n

OSX 似乎不支持这个 \xe2\x80\x94 是真的吗?

\n\n

如果是这样,实施它的最佳方法是什么?由于我在 OSX 上进行开发,但在 Linux 上运行生产代码,因此我需要使用 crond 而不是 launchd,即使后者具有潜在的好处。

\n

osx cron

6
推荐指数
1
解决办法
2171
查看次数

find 显示双正斜杠可以吗?

这是一个错误,当find ./path/here/我得到:

./path/here//foo
./path/here//bar
Run Code Online (Sandbox Code Playgroud)

我知道find希望我指定不带斜杠的路径,但它肯定可以检测到制表符完成留给我的路径并相应地调整其输出。有什么理由不这样做吗?

slash find filenames macos

5
推荐指数
1
解决办法
779
查看次数

标签 统计

command-line ×1

cron ×1

filenames ×1

find ×1

macos ×1

osx ×1

slash ×1